Beyond the numbers

What each city asks you to trade

Costs and scores help narrow the choice. These practical strengths and limitations finish the picture.

Urumqi China

Strengths

  • Very low cost of living compared to eastern China
  • Rich Uyghur and Central Asian culture
  • Delicious and diverse local cuisine
  • Generally safe streets with visible police presence
  • Gateway to the Silk Road and stunning natural landscapes
  • Friendly locals who are curious about foreigners

Trade-offs

  • Significant language barrier with minimal English spoken
  • Poor air quality, especially in winter due to coal heating
  • Extreme continental climate with freezing winters and hot summers
  • Limited expat community and few coworking spaces
  • Strict visa regulations and visa runs require planning
  • Censored internet requiring a reliable VPN at all times

Common visa routes

  • Tourist visa (L)
  • Business visa (M)
  • Work visa (Z)
Kyiv Ukraine

Strengths

  • Affordable cost of living
  • Vibrant cultural scene
  • Good internet connectivity
  • Historic architecture
  • Friendly locals
  • Central European location

Trade-offs

  • Ongoing war risk
  • Air raid sirens
  • Cold winters
  • Corruption in bureaucracy
  • Language barrier outside Kyiv
  • Limited nightlife due to curfew

Common visa routes

  • Visa-free (90 days for many)
  • e-Visa (30 days for some)
  • Temporary residence permit (up to 1 year)
